The document provides detailed specifications for the Cummins 6CTAA8.3 series diesel generator set, which offers standby power ratings between 176 kW and 230 kW. It features a heavy-duty engine, advanced control systems, and various options for fuel and cooling systems, ensuring reliability and compliance with industry standards. The generator set is designed for both stationary standby and prime power applications, with a comprehensive warranty and service support.

Generator set specifications
Governor regulation class ISO 8528 Part 1 Class G3
Voltage regulation, no load to full load ± 0.5%
Random voltage variation ± 0.5%
Frequency regulation Isochronous
Random frequency variation ± 0.25%
Radio frequency emissions compliance Meets requirements of most industrial and commercial applications.

Engine specifications
Bore 114.0 mm (4.49 in)
Stroke 135.1 mm (5.32 in)
3
Displacement 8.3 L (504.0 in )
Configuration Cast iron, in-line 6 cylinder
Battery capacity 550 amps minimum at ambient temperature of 0 °C (32 °F)
Battery charging alternator 65 amps
Starting voltage 12 volt, negative ground
Direct injection: number 2 diesel fuel, fuel filter, automatic electric
Fuel system
fuel shutoff
Single element, 10 micron filtration, spin-on fuel filter with water
Fuel filter
separator
Air cleaner type Dry replaceable element
Lube oil filter type(s) Spin-on, full flow
Standard cooling system 40 °C (104 °F) ambient radiator

Alternator specifications
Design Brushless, 4 pole, drip proof revolving field
Stator 2/3 pitch
Rotor Single bearing, flexible discs
Insulation system Class H
Standard temperature rise 150 ºC standby at 40 °C ambient
Exciter type Torque match (shunt)
Phase rotation A (U), B (V), C (W)
Alternator cooling Direct drive centrifugal blower
AC waveform total harmonic distortion < 5% no load to full linear load, < 3% for any single harmonic
Telephone influence factor (TIF) < 50 per NEMA MG1-22.43
Telephone harmonic factor (THF) <3

Ratings definitions
Emergency standby power (ESP):
Applicable for supplying power to varying electrical load
for the duration of power interruption of a reliable utility
source. Emergency Standby Power (ESP) is in
accordance with ISO 8528. Fuel Stop power in
accordance with ISO 3046, AS 2789, DIN 6271 and BS
5514.
Limited-time running power (LTP):
Applicable for supplying power to a constant electrical
load for limited hours. Limited Time Running Power (LTP)
is in accordance with ISO 8528.
Prime power (PRP):
Applicable for supplying power to varying electrical load
for unlimited hours. Prime Power (PRP) is in accordance
with ISO 8528. Ten percent overload capability is
available in accordance with ISO 3046, AS 2789, DIN
6271 and BS 5514.
Base load (continuous) power (COP):
